Picture Profi les
Up to 16 combinations of picture adjustment values (in the PICTURE menu and ADVANCED SETTINGS) can be stored 
in the display memory as profi les and applied as needed, for a convenient way to enjoy your preferred picture settings. 
Note: 
If setting items (PITCURE menu and ADVANCED SETTINGS) are set differently between MEMORY SAVE and 
MEMORY LOAD, they may not refl ect for MEMORY LOAD.
